Introduction to Bone Broth
Bone broth is a liquid made by simmering animal bones, typically from beef, chicken, or fish, in water. It’s an excellent source of protein, collagen, proline, glycosaminoglycans (GAGs), and minerals like calcium, magnesium, and phosphorus. The slow cooking process breaks down the collagen in the bones, releasing these nutrients into the broth, which can then be easily absorbed by the body. Bone broth has been associated with a range of health benefits, including improved digestion, reduced inflammation, and enhanced skin, hair, and nail health.

The Role of Pressure Cooking
Traditional bone broth recipes require simmering the bones for an extended period, typically 12 to 24 hours, to extract the maximum amount of nutrients. However, with the use of a pressure cooker, this time can be significantly reduced to as little as 30 minutes to 2 hours, depending on the type of bones and the desired consistency of the broth. Pressure cooking not only saves time but also ensures a more efficient extraction of nutrients from the bones, potentially leading to a more nutrient-dense broth.
Pressure Cooking Times for Bone Broth
The key to making a nutritious and delicious bone broth in a pressure cooker is understanding the optimal cooking times. This can vary based on the type and quantity of bones, the power of the pressure cooker, and personal preference regarding the broth’s richness and clarity. Here are some general guidelines for pressure cooking bone broth:
When cooking beef bones, 30 to 60 minutes under pressure is often recommended. For chicken bones, 15 to 30 minutes can be sufficient, while fish bones typically require the least amount of time, 5 to 15 minutes. It’s also important to note that these times can be adjusted based on whether you’re using a stovetop pressure cooker, an electric pressure cooker, or an Instant Pot, as each has its own specific guidelines and power levels.
Factors Influencing Cooking Time
Several factors can influence the ideal cooking time for bone broth in a pressure cooker. These include:
– Type and Quality of Bones: Different types of bones (beef, chicken, fish) have varying densities and collagen content, affecting how quickly they release their nutrients.
– Quantity of Bones and Water: The ratio of bones to water can impact the richness and cooking time of the broth. More bones generally require more time to extract the desired amount of nutrients.
– Desired Broth Consistency: Some prefer a lighter, more brothy consistency, while others like a richer, thicker broth, which may require longer cooking times.
– Pressure Cooker Model: Different pressure cookers have varying power levels and cooking efficiencies, which can significantly affect cooking times.
Adjusting Cooking Times
To adjust cooking times, it’s essential to start with the minimum recommended time for your type of bones and then check the broth for desired consistency and flavor. If the broth is not rich enough or the bones still have a significant amount of marrow, additional cooking time in increments of 15 minutes can be added until the desired outcome is achieved.

Can I use a water bath canner to can bone broth, or is a pressure canner necessary?
While a water bath canner can be used for canning high-acid foods like jams and pickles, it is not suitable for canning low-acid foods like bone broth. Bone broth is a low-acid food that requires a higher temperature to kill off bacteria and other microorganisms, making a pressure canner necessary for safe and effective canning. A pressure canner can reach temperatures of up to 240°F (115°C), which is hot enough to kill off even the most heat-resistant bacteria, such as Clostridium botulinum.
Using a pressure canner to can bone broth is essential for ensuring the broth is safe to eat and retains its nutritional value. A pressure canner allows for the precise control of temperature and pressure, which is critical for killing off bacteria and preserving the delicate nutrients found in bone broth. In contrast, a water bath canner may not be able to reach the necessary temperatures, which can lead to spoilage, nutrient loss, and even foodborne illness. By using a pressure canner, individuals can ensure that their bone broth is canned safely and effectively, making it a healthy and delicious addition to their diet.
